Why Scalp Health Matters for Hair Strength
Your scalp hosts follicles that produce hair strands. When follicles are nourished, your hair grows thicker and falls less. When they’re blocked or stressed, you see thinning and excessive shedding.
Common Signs of an Unhealthy Scalp
Itchiness or flakes
Excess oil or dryness
Hair fall beyond normal
Slow hair growth
Weak or brittle strands
How Poor Scalp Health Leads to Hair Fall
A buildup of sebum, dirt, or product can suffocate follicles. This reduces oxygen flow and weakens the root, causing hair to shed before its natural cycle completes.

The Role of Scalp Care in Hair Strength
Your scalp needs regular cleansing and exfoliation to remove buildup.
Why Use a Scalp Scrub?
A scalp scrub exfoliates dead skin and unclogs follicles. This improves blood circulation and allows nutrients to reach your roots.
Dry Scalp Treatment at Home
You can fix mild dryness naturally:
Warm oil massage using Pure Coconut Oil
Aloe vera gel application
Gentle sulfate-free shampoo
Overnight hydration mask

Hair Strengthening Food
What you eat directly affects your hair. Include:
Eggs (protein + biotin)
Nuts & seeds (omega fats)
Leafy greens (iron)
Berries (antioxidants)
pH-Balanced Formula
An optimal shampoo maintains a pH level ranging from 4.5 to 5.5. This range safeguards the scalp barrier, reduces frizz, and fortifies cuticles.
